10 for both of my kids experiences.. Both of my sons used Defensive Drive this last year at separate locations. Both situations were good, however I felt the Everett experience provided a little more traffic experience, but both the teachers were great and the behind the wheel teachers did a good job training them on rules and now they are great drivers as well as great back seat drivers.. amazing how many little rules as a parent we forget, good refresher for me as well. They were great at doing their best to accommodate drive time that worked for us in both cases. I would recommend them.. I was a bit sticker shocked at all the market prices for this, in my day, I am old I know, behind the wheel was paid for by the school and part of our high school curriculum, which I would prefer over some things that are currently required.. other then cost and theirs is very much the going rate, I thought it was a very well taught course for both of my kids.
Pros: Great school/education
Cons: What happened to free drivers ed:-)
